Which of the following is NOT a test of ovarian reserve during the early follicular phase?

Explanation

  • Anti-Müllerian Hormone (AMH) is a key hormone for assessing ovarian reserve, as it is produced by the granulosa cells of small, growing follicles.
  • The primary advantage of AMH testing is that its levels are relatively stable and consistent throughout the menstrual cycle.
  • Because AMH is not dependent on the cycle stage, it can be measured on any day, unlike other markers that must be timed to the early follicular phase.
  • This cycle independence makes AMH a convenient and reliable marker for the remaining egg supply.

Why Other Options Were Wrong

  • Option A: Basal Follicle-Stimulating Hormone (FSH) level is a standard test for ovarian reserve that is specifically measured in the early follicular phase (days 2-4 of the menstrual cycle).
  • Option B: Estradiol (E2) levels are measured along with FSH in the early follicular phase (days 2-4) to help interpret the FSH results and provide a more complete picture of ovarian function.
  • Option D: Antral Follicle Count (AFC) is a transvaginal ultrasound examination performed in the early follicular phase to count the number of small, resting follicles, which directly relates to ovarian reserve.

Clinical Relevance

  • Assessing ovarian reserve is a critical step in fertility evaluation, helping to guide treatment decisions, predict response to ovarian stimulation for procedures like IVF, and counsel patients on their reproductive potential.
  • For nurses in fertility clinics, understanding the timing and significance of these tests is essential for patient education, scheduling appointments correctly, and interpreting results for the clinical team.
  • What if? If a patient has highly irregular or absent menstrual cycles, AMH testing becomes particularly valuable because it does not require timing to a specific cycle day, unlike FSH, E2, and AFC.
